SECTION 4
Programming Overview
T
he control panel incorporates a menu text driven
interface. This interface is very similar to that found on
many mobile phones. Once programming mode is entered
you will see a number of menu options in the display and
these may vary depending in the user authority level.
ENTERING PROGRAMMING MODE
To enter installer program mode, enter PIN + [MENU].
The default Installer PIN is 1234.
The Red and Green LED indicators on the keypad will flash
to confirm Installer programming mode is active.
EXITING PROGRAMMING MODE
Press and hold down the [MENU] key for 2 seconds.
The system will scan all timezones and peform the
functions relative to the current system. For example if a
timed output should be operated then it will operate and
if the system should be armed it will arm.
You can also select Exit and press [OK] from each
menu level.
COMMAND MENUS
When you first enter programming mode, a special menu
called the 'Command Menu' will appear at the top of the
menu tree. The command menu provides a list of the most
common system funtions like “Turn Chime Mode On”,
“Move To An Area” or “Turn An Area On”.
Use the up and down arrow keys to navigate and press
[OK] to select the command required.
PROGRAMMING OPTION BIT MENUS
Use the up and down arrow keys to scroll through the 8
different options. To enable an option, press the [ON] key
– a tick will be displayed. To disable an option, press the
[OFF] key.

To save programming changes, press [OK] or press [MENU]
to exit without saving.
NAVIGATING THE MENUS
Using the up and down arrow keys to navigate, locate the
desired menu item using the highlight bar and then press
the [OK] key to select.
A new list of menu items will appear. Repeat the above
until the desired menu item is located.
To navigate backwards through the menu items press
the [MENU] key at any time. Alternatively if you know the
direct menu item number press [MENU] + Item Number.

LIST OPTIONS
Use the up and down arrow keys to step through the
available options. Press [OK] to save or [MENU] to exit
without saving.

You can also enter the option number directly
followed by [OK]. You must press the [OK] a second
time to confirm the current setting.
